Abstract

The invention relates to the field of communication and discloses a carrier repeater. The carrier relay includes: the three groups of signal coupling circuits are connected with the three-phase power lines in a one-to-one corresponding mode and are used for coupling carrier signals from the three-phase power lines respectively; three switch pairs, each switch pair comprises a transmitting switch and a receiving switch, and the three switch pairs are connected with the three groups of signal coupling circuits in a one-to-one corresponding mode; and a processor, comprising: the control module is used for controlling the receiving switches in the three switch pairs to be closed so as to receive the carrier signals; and the control module is also used for controlling the action of the switch pair corresponding to the specific phase power line so as to forward the carrier signal through the specific phase power line under the condition that the carrier signal comes from the specific phase power line in the three-phase power line. The invention can realize the accurate forwarding of the high-speed power line carrier signal in the three-phase four-wire system power supply network through one carrier repeater.

Background
High-speed Power L (High speed Power Communication, abbreviated as HP L C) refers to Communication in a manner that a Power transmission line is used as a Carrier transmission medium.
In a network using a high-speed power line carrier communication system, the communication effect is greatly affected by the installation environment of the power line. For example, when the power line between the concentrator and the electric meter of the three-phase power line is long, the middle of the power supply line passes through the multi-stage circuit breaker and the branch switch, or because of the load of the power supply line, the power consumption condition, the interference of the power grid, or the change of the environmental temperature and humidity, the high-speed power line carrier communication network may not be able to be networked or the networking is unstable, thereby resulting in low reliability of the service function.
At present, in order to solve the problem of unstable high-speed power line carrier communication, a method mainly adopted is to directly increase the power line carrier transmission power or add a carrier repeater at a proper node. The two methods mainly have the following defects: on one hand, according to the technical specification of a communication unit of the technical specification of the power consumer electricity utilization information acquisition system of the enterprise standard Q/GDW 1374.3 of the national grid company, the in-band emission power of the power line carrier communication module cannot exceed-45 dBm/Hz, so that the problem of unstable high-speed power line carrier communication cannot be completely solved by increasing the emission power of the carrier; on the other hand, the existing carrier repeater is designed for a single-phase power line, and specifically, one carrier repeater is added to each phase line with poor communication effect. In a common three-phase four-wire power supply network, if the power line carrier communication effect on each phase line is not good, one single-phase carrier repeater needs to be added on each phase line, and the total number of the single-phase carrier repeaters is three, so that the basic cost is greatly increased.

Before specifically describing the embodiments of the present invention, a brief description will be given of a power consumption information collecting communication network.
In actual application, the transformer 7 converts the high-voltage power into voltage for users to use, and then the voltage is transmitted to each user through the A/B/C three-phase and zero line. The power consumption information collection communication network of the power consumer is composed of a CCO (Central Coordinator) 6 installed in a three-phase four-wire concentrator 5 as a master control end, STAs (stations) in single-phase meters (e.g., STA 11 in the a-phase single-phase meter 1, STA 21 in the B-phase single-phase meter 2, and STA31 in the C-phase single-phase meter 3) arranged on different phases, and STA41 in the three-phase meter 4 as clients. The CCO in the concentrator may transmit broadcast signals on the a/B/C three phases simultaneously or transmit signals on a certain phase separately during actual operation, as shown in fig. 3.
In addition, the format of the carrier communication packet (or carrier signal) includes: the source Terminal Equipment Identity (TEI), i.e. the TEI of the device sending out the carrier signal, the destination TEI (the TEI of the device to be accessed), the source MAC address (the MAC address of the device sending out the carrier signal) and the destination MAC address (the MAC address of the device to be accessed). And in the networking process, the CCO allocates and stores a mapping relation table of the TEI and the MAC address. If the CCO needs to access the repeater itself, the source TEI is the CCO's TEI and the destination TEI is the repeater TEI; the source MAC address is the MAC address of the CCO and the destination MAC address is the MAC address of the repeater. If the electric equipment connected with the repeater needs to be accessed, the source TEI is the TEI of the CCO, and the destination TEI is the repeater TEI; the source MAC address is the MAC address of the CCO, and the destination MAC address is the MAC address of the electric equipment.
Fig. 1 is a structural diagram of a carrier relay according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 1, the carrier relay 8 may include: the three sets of signal coupling circuits 10, 20 and 30 are connected with the three-phase power line in a one-to-one correspondence manner and are used for coupling carrier signals from the three-phase power line respectively; three switch pairs 100, 200, 300, each of the three switch pairs 100, 200, 300 comprising a transmit switch (e.g., 101, 201, 301) and a receive switch (e.g., 102, 202, 302), the three switch pairs 100, 200, 300 being connected with the three sets of signal coupling circuits 10, 20, 30 in a one-to-one correspondence; and a processor 40, the processor 40 comprising: a control module 50, configured to control the receiving switches in the three switch pairs to be closed to receive the carrier signal; and a determining module 60, configured to analyze a source of the carrier signal, as shown in fig. 2. Correspondingly, the control module 50 is further configured to, in a case where the carrier signal is from a specific phase power line of the three-phase power lines, control the switch pair corresponding to the specific phase power line to operate according to the time slot allocated by the carrier signal, so as to forward the carrier signal through the specific phase power line. Therefore, the carrier signal to be forwarded to the single-phase power line is transmitted on the corresponding single-phase power line, and compared with the existing forwarding strategy (the same carrier signal is transmitted on the 3-phase power line at the same time, and the energy on each phase power line is only 1/3), the energy on the corresponding single-phase power line is 3 times larger, so that the transmission power of the signal can be greatly improved, and the transmission distance of the signal is greatly increased. The embodiment of the invention can meet the relay forwarding function of the three-phase power line carrier signal through one carrier repeater, thereby reducing the overall cost of product maintenance, installation and hardware.
The signal coupling circuit 10 is connected with an A phase and a zero line of a power supply network, and is used for coupling a carrier signal from the phase of an A phase power line; the signal coupling circuit 20 is connected with a phase B and a zero line of a power supply network and is used for coupling a carrier signal from a phase B power line phase; similarly, the signal coupling circuit 30 is connected to the C-phase and neutral lines of the power supply network for coupling the carrier signal in phase from the C-phase power line.
The processor 40 further comprises: and the other at least one switch of the at least four control I/O interfaces is connected with the receiving switch of the three switch pairs and is used for realizing the receiving and the transmitting of the carrier signal.
Specifically, in the case that the at least four control I/O interfaces are six control I/O interfaces, the six control I/O interfaces are connected to each of the three switch pairs in a one-to-one correspondence manner, as shown in fig. 1. That is to say, the actions of the A-phase transmitting switch, the A-phase receiving switch, the B-phase transmitting switch, the B-phase receiving switch, the C-phase transmitting switch and the C-phase receiving switch are respectively controlled by the A-phase transmitting control interface, the A-phase receiving control interface, the B-phase transmitting control interface, the B-phase receiving control interface, the C-phase transmitting control interface and the C-phase receiving control interface, so that the receiving and the transmitting of the carrier signals on the A/B/C three phases of the power line are respectively controlled. In the case where the at least four control I/O interfaces are four control I/O interfaces (not shown), three of the four control I/O interfaces and the transmit switch of the three switch pairs
Connected in a one-to-one correspondence, the other control I/O interface is connected to three receiving switches of the three switch pairs. That is, the a-phase receiving control interface, the B-phase receiving control interface and the C-phase receiving control interface can be combined into one control I/O interface, so that only 4 control I/O interfaces are needed, thereby saving the equipment cost.
The carrier signal may be not only a signal intended to be forwarded to the individual phase meters, but possibly also to the repeater itself to control it to perform certain processing. Therefore, in the embodiment of the present invention, it may be determined whether a destination Terminal Equipment Identity (TEI) carried by a carrier signal is a TEI of a repeater itself, and if the destination TEI is the TEI of the repeater itself, the repeater is controlled to communicate with a device (or a destination device, such as an electrical device or a circuit breaker) connected to the repeater.
The determining module 60 is further configured to analyze an association relationship between a destination TEI and a destination MAC Address (media access Control Address) in the carrier signal and the carrier relay. Correspondingly, the control module 50 is further configured to communicate with the electrical equipment according to the carrier signal if the destination TEI in the carrier signal is the TEI of the carrier repeater and the destination MAC address in the carrier signal is the MAC address of the electrical equipment connected to the carrier repeater. And, the control module 50 is further configured to feed back a result corresponding to the carrier signal acquired from the electric device after the communication with the electric device is completed.
The processor 40 may further include: the RS485 interface 70, the RS485 interface 70 is connected to the electric device, and correspondingly, the controlling module 50 is configured to communicate with the electric device according to the carrier signal, and includes: and under the condition that the carrier signal is used for inquiring or acquiring the related data of the electric equipment, inquiring or acquiring the related data of the electric equipment through the RS485 interface 70.
Specifically, the control module 50 may query the relevant data of the electricity meter 9 through the RS485 interface 70, when the destination TEI of the carrier signal obtained through the analysis by the determination module is the TEI of the carrier relay itself, the destination MAC address in the carrier signal is the MAC address of the electricity meter connected to the carrier relay, and the carrier signal is the relevant data for querying the electricity meter. And, after querying the relevant data of the electricity meter 9, the control module 50 is further configured to feed back the queried relevant data of the electricity meter 9 to a concentrator, as shown in fig. 3. Therefore, the carrier repeater can be used as an independent device for collecting the electricity utilization information of the electricity utilization device.
In addition, the carrier signal may also be a broadcast message forwarded to the three-phase electric meter, so in the embodiment of the present invention, it may be determined whether the carrier signal is a broadcast signal, and in the case that the carrier signal is a broadcast signal, the three switch pairs are controlled to act to forward the carrier signal through the three-phase power line.
The determining module 60 is further configured to determine whether the carrier signal is a broadcast signal when the target TEI in the carrier signal is not the TEI of the carrier repeater. Correspondingly, the control module 50 is further configured to control the three switch pairs to act according to the time slot allocated by the carrier signal when the carrier signal is a broadcast signal, so as to forward the carrier signal through the three-phase power line.
And, the control module 50 is further configured to control the receiving switches in the three switch pairs to close after the carrier signal is forwarded, so as to continue receiving the carrier signal. That is, after the carrier signal is forwarded, the three-phase power lines are all in a monitoring state.
Before executing the embodiments of the present invention, it is necessary to know the phases to which the respective power lines connected to the carrier relay belong (i.e., which line is the a-phase power line, which line is the B-phase power line, and which line is the C-phase power line), and thus, in order to identify the specific phases of the respective power lines connected to the carrier relay, a zero-cross detection module having a phase identification function may be provided in the embodiments of the present invention. The carrier relay may further include: and a zero-crossing detection module 80, configured to identify respective phases to which the three-phase power lines belong. Specifically, the phases of the leftmost power line, the middle power line and the rightmost power line in fig. 1 are identified and obtained by the zero-crossing detection module 80 as an a phase, a B phase and a C phase, respectively; on this basis, the processor receives the carrier signal from a specific phase power line (e.g., phase a) by controlling a receiving switch corresponding to the specific phase power line (e.g., phase a) to be closed, and controls the switch corresponding to the specific phase power line (e.g., phase a) to operate in a relative manner according to a time slot allocated by the carrier signal, so as to forward the carrier signal through the specific phase power line (e.g., phase a). In addition, the zero-crossing detection module 80 can also be used to detect whether the repeater has a power failure, so as to implement a power failure reporting function.
In order to supply power to the carrier repeater, a power supply module for taking power from a phase line and a zero line of a three-phase four-wire system can be arranged in the embodiment of the invention, so that the repeater can still work normally when a certain phase in the A/B/C three-phase is powered off. The carrier relay may further include: a power supply module 90 connected to any one of the three-phase power lines and a zero line, for obtaining power to supply power to the carrier repeater; and/or a memory 110 for storing the relevant programs and relevant parameters in the carrier repeater. The power supply module 90 obtains power from any one phase power line and a zero line of a three-phase four-wire system, and supplies power to each module in the carrier repeater after voltage conversion. For example, fig. 1 shows that the power supply module 90 takes power from a C-phase power line and a zero line as a power supply of the repeater, and can take power from any phase of a/B/C in practical application.

Specifically, the work flow of the carrier repeater will be explained and explained by taking the high-speed power line carrier application network composed in fig. 3 as an example, as shown in fig. 4.
The work flow of the carrier relay may include the following steps S401-S409.
Step S401, the processor controls the A/B/C phase receiving switch to be closed completely through the A/B/C phase receiving control I/O interface, so that the processor is in a three-phase receiving state.
At this time, all the A/B/C phase transmitting switches are in an off state.
In step S402, the processor receives a carrier signal.
Step S403, determining whether the target TEI carried by the carrier signal is a TEI of the carrier relay, if so, executing step S404; otherwise, step S406 is performed.
Step S404, judging whether the destination MAC address carried by the carrier signal is the MAC address of the ammeter connected with the carrier repeater, if so, executing step S405; otherwise, step S401 is executed.
And S405, communicating with the ammeter through an RS485 interface, and returning a communication result.
If the message received by the carrier relay is sent to the carrier relay, the message is not forwarded and is processed. If the message is required to be sent to the self-contained electric equipment, the message is communicated with the self-contained electric equipment through an RS485 interface, and a processing result is returned to the concentrator. Otherwise, the process returns to step S401, and the repeater is still in the three-phase receiving state.
Step S406, determining whether the carrier signal is a broadcast message, if so, performing step S407; otherwise, step S408 is performed.
If the carrier signal is not the message sent to the repeater, the judgment is made again to judge whether the carrier signal is a broadcast message or not
And step S407, controlling three switch pairs to act according to the allocated time slots in the carrier signal so as to forward the carrier signal through the three-phase power line.
If the message is a broadcast message, according to the time slot allocated in the received message, the receiving switches in the three switch pairs are opened (to close the receiving channel) through the a/B/C phase receiving control I/O interface, then the transmitting switches in the three switch pairs are closed (to open the three-phase transmitting channel) through the a/B/C phase transmitting control I/O interface, the message is simultaneously forwarded on the a/B/C three-phase power line, and finally the message is forwarded to all STAs in fig. 3, such as STA 11, STA 21, STA31, and STA 41. And after the forwarding is finished, the three-phase transmitting path is still closed, and the repeater is switched to a three-phase receiving state.
Step S408, judging which phase of the A/B/C phase power line the carrier signal comes from.
And step S409, controlling the corresponding switch pair in the three switch pairs to act according to the time slot allocated in the carrier signal so as to forward the carrier signal through the corresponding power line.
If not, it is determined from which phase the message was received (e.g., it is determined that the message was received from the a-phase power line), and according to the time slot allocated in the received message, the corresponding transmit switch (e.g., transmit switch 101) opens the transmit channel of the corresponding phase, and forwards the message on the corresponding phase (e.g., a-phase power line), and finally the message is forwarded to STA 11 and STA41 in fig. 3. Since the STA41 is a three-phase electric meter, it will also receive the message, but the three-phase electric meter STA41 will determine the destination TEI therein after receiving the message, and will automatically discard if it is not the own TEI. And after the forwarding is finished, closing the transmitting channel and switching the repeater to a three-phase receiving state.
Due to the wiring influence of the three-phase four-wire system power supply line, the power line carrier communication signal is possibly coupled to other phases from the signal originally on the single phase, so that the carrier repeater provided by the embodiment of the invention can also have the function of repeating communication messages to reduce the self-interference of the high-speed power line carrier communication network.
Therefore, the three-phase high-speed power line carrier repeater provided by each embodiment of the invention only has one high-speed power line carrier communication processor, utilizes different control IO interfaces to perform coupling control on carrier signals on a three-phase power line, and utilizes the characteristics of time-sharing receiving and transmitting of the high-speed power line carrier signals to complete the function of relaying and forwarding the high-speed power line carrier signals. When the high-speed power line carrier communication processor works, the A/B/C phase three-phase receiving switches are all closed, and meanwhile, the A/B/C phase transmitting switches are all disconnected through the A/B/C phase transmitting control I/O interface, so that the high-speed power line carrier communication processor is in a receiving state, and at the moment, the carrier repeater is in a three-phase signal all monitoring state. When the carrier signal of any phase is received, the judgment processing is carried out, whether the message is sent to the self or other modules is judged, and the message is respectively forwarded on the corresponding phase line according to the received phase. If the message is broadcast, the message needs to be forwarded on the three-phase power line simultaneously.
